Searching for and in online reference books
If searching the Catalog:
1. Select "Advanced Search"
2. In the "Material Type" pulldown menu select "E-Book"
3. Enter "reference" in one of the search boxes
4. Enter your search term(s) in the other(s)
A catalog search will not search WITHIN the reference books. To do that check out these three databases of online reference books.
GALE VIRTUAL REFERENCE LIBRARY
This is a database of encyclopedias, almanacs, and specialized reference sources for multidisciplinary research.
1. To access it use the Infotrac PowerSearch database
2. Enter your search term(s)
3. Click on the "Reference" tab

NETLIBRARY
Provides a growing collection of over 33,000 eBooks. Most are recent, but our subscription includes a collection of free eBooks which has many literary classics. You must set up an individual user name and password with netLibrary to check out eBooks. **Only one person may view a particular book at any one time.**
Click on the "Reference Center" link to access NetLibrary's reference collection.
OXFORD REFERENCE ONLINE PREMIUM
Multi-part database of the online versions of Oxford University Press texts. Each topical division contains the searchable version of the latest edition of published dictionaries and encyclopedias.
